AI in web development is reshaping how teams design, code, and deploy sites with smarter tooling. From AI-assisted web development platforms to automated testing and content generation, the workflow is accelerating. This shift invites reflection on the impact of AI on developers and how roles must adapt. Practicing prompting for AI coding helps teams build reliable prototypes faster while keeping oversight tight. As adoption grows, we weigh the future of software development with AI and the need for robust AI security in software.
Beyond the hype, intelligent tooling for the web is pushing development toward faster prototyping and modular architectures. This shift is often described as AI-powered code creation, automated coding assistants, and data-informed design, all reflecting Latent Semantic Indexing (LSI) connections to the core topic. What matters is how these smart aids alter workflows, testing, security posture, and the skills developers bring to projects. As we navigate adoption, stakeholders consider prompt-based coding, model governance, and the balance between automation and human oversight. The broader trajectory points to a future where software construction is increasingly collaborative between humans and intelligent systems.
AI-Assisted Web Development: Transforming Workflow and Efficiency
The rise of AI-assisted web development is reshaping how we work by taking over repetitive tasks, generating scaffolds, and offering code patterns that speed up project cycles. In my experience, AI-assisted workflows have turned hours of manual setup into minutes of assembly, especially when building plugins or utilities. Tools and prompts helped me create the WordPress.com Content Calendar in roughly two hours, with Perplexity handling research and Cursor guiding assembly.
But AI is a tool, not a replacement. It shines when paired with human judgment, rigorous testing, and ongoing security reviews. To stay productive, we need to apply solid software development practices—define scope, write tests early, and continuously validate AI-generated code—while using AI to augment our capabilities rather than bypass our expertise.
AI in Web Development: From Hype to Real-World Adoption
There’s a lot of hype around AI, especially on social media, but real-world adoption tends to be deliberate and pragmatic. The journey mirrors the early days of steam-powered vehicles: initial fears were justified, yet the technology gradually reshaped how people move and work. Now, AI in web development sits at the threshold of a revolution where practical tools start delivering measurable value.
My own projects illustrate this shift from hype to habit. I’ve relied on AI-assisted approaches since GPT-3 and Copilot, using them to generate code, docs, and tutorials. Real progress comes when AI complements human capability—producing faster outputs, while humans apply domain knowledge, perform security reviews, and ensure quality in production environments.
Impact of AI on Developers: Shifting Roles and Skill Requirements
The impact of AI on developers is less about replacement and more about evolution. As AI takes on more scaffolding, debugging, and boilerplate generation, developers increasingly focus on defining problems, guiding prompts, and validating results. This shift elevates the role of critical thinking, architecture decisions, and ethical considerations in software projects.
With that shift comes a need for upskilling. Learning prompting for AI coding, understanding context windows, and mastering the right toolchains become core competencies. The future of software development with AI hinges on developers who combine technical depth with the judgment to oversee AI outputs and drive responsible innovation.
Prompting for AI Coding: Best Practices for Reliable AI-Generated Code
Prompting for AI coding is a discipline in itself. Clear objectives, defined scope, and iterative prompts reduce drift and misinterpretation. I’ve found that starting with a concrete prompt, validating the AI’s output against real-world requirements, and then refining the prompt based on results yields the most reliable code.
Best practices include setting success criteria early, running tests as part of every iteration, and ensuring that a human reviews and refactors AI-produced code. This approach aligns with the idea that AI should support coding—not replace human oversight—while also enabling faster delivery and more consistent documentation.
AI Security in Software: Guardrails, Vulnerabilities, and Safeguards
Security concerns around AI-generated software are real. Stories of data leakage, misconfigurations, or misinterpretations by AI agents highlight the need for strong guardrails and ongoing audits. When AI systems generate or modify production code, we must treat the results with skepticism and subject them to rigorous security checks.
Safeguards include robust security audits, threat modeling, access controls, and validation of anonymization vs sanitization routines. The goal is to harness AI’s productivity gains while maintaining the same or higher standards for reliability, privacy, and resilience in software systems.
Measuring Productivity: AI Tools That Speed Up Web Projects
AI tools have demonstrably sped up real projects, from research and planning to implementation. For example, I’ve used AI-powered assistants to accelerate the creation of a WordPress content calendar, to draft and organize tutorials, and to assemble UI prototypes in a fraction of the time it took before.
The trade-off is that speed must be matched with discipline: validate outputs with tests, watch for edge cases, and ensure maintainability. When used thoughtfully, AI becomes a productivity accelerator that preserves quality and improves delivery timelines without eroding professional judgment.
Data Privacy, Anonymization, and Compliance in AI-Driven Development
A recurring caution in AI-driven development is the difference between sanitization and anonymization. It’s easy to generate suggestions that sound plausible but don’t actually protect user data or meet regulatory requirements. Real-world projects must distinguish between sanitizing content for display and properly anonymizing sensitive information before storage or transmission.
Practices to safeguard privacy include clear data-handling policies, rigorous anonymization strategies, and proactive security reviews. By embedding privacy-by-default into AI workflows, teams can enjoy productivity gains while preserving user trust and regulatory compliance.
Automation vs. Craft: Balancing Human Oversight in AI-Driven Projects
At the end of the day, AI development tools are most effective when used as productivity aids rather than replacements for human expertise. Automation can handle repetitive tasks, but complex decisions, user experiences, and robust security require human judgment and craftsmanship.
To strike the right balance, teams should define project scope clearly, implement continuous reviews, and maintain documentation that explains why AI-generated decisions were accepted or rejected. This disciplined approach preserves quality and invites ongoing learning as AI capabilities evolve.
Future of Software Development with AI: Predictions and Preparations
The future of software development with AI is not a distant dream but an imminent shift that accelerates outcomes and broadens capability. As tools become more capable, projects that once took days or weeks can reach completion in hours, provided teams maintain discipline around testing, security, and governance.
Preparing for that future means investing in education, building shared best practices, and fostering a culture of continuous improvement. Developers should learn prompting, stay current with AI tooling, and embrace robust security audits to offset skill erosion and ensure sustainable progress.
AI in web development: Architecture, Frontend, and Backend Innovations
AI in web development is influencing architecture choices, enabling smarter frontends, and assisting backend workflows with generated APIs and data handling patterns. Teams can leverage AI to draft component trees, optimize rendering paths, and suggest scalable patterns that align with modern web standards.
This evolution requires careful integration: we must validate AI-suggested designs, maintain clear separation of concerns, and ensure compatibility with existing tooling. By treating AI-generated suggestions as options to evaluate—rather than final prescriptions—developers can innovate responsibly while maintaining system stability.
Real-World AI-Driven Web Solutions: Plugins, Calendars, and Debugging Tools
Concrete examples from my work illustrate how AI-driven solutions become a practical part of daily development. Building plugins, automating workflows, and creating utilities like a WordPress calendar can be accomplished quickly with AI assistance, while still relying on human QA and user feedback.
Tools such as Cursor for integration, Perplexity for research, and other AI helpers demonstrate both the gains and the pitfalls of AI-driven development. The key lesson is to deploy AI thoughtfully, validate results in real environments, and iteratively refine tools based on real user needs and security considerations.
Education and Community: Upskilling for the AI-Powered Development Landscape
As AI becomes a staple in web development, ongoing education and a supportive community are essential. Developers benefit from learning to prompt effectively, understand context, and navigate the broader toolchain of AI-enabled workflows. Knowledge sharing—through blogs, forums, and open-source projects—helps spread best practices and reduces the fear of obsolescence.
Communities that emphasize continuous learning, security awareness, and responsible AI usage will lead the way. By investing in education and collaboration, the industry can harness AI’s potential while preserving the human creativity and oversight that drive truly innovative software.
Frequently Asked Questions
How is AI-assisted web development changing the role of developers in today’s projects?
AI-assisted web development shifts focus from writing routine code to designing architecture, validating AI outputs, and integrating AI tools. Developers act as copilots who review prompts, test results, and ensure quality and security.
What is the impact of AI on developers’ jobs, and should I be worried?
AI may automate repetitive tasks but also creates opportunities in AI governance, prompt engineering, and secure coding. The impact depends on how you adapt, learn new skills, and maintain human oversight.
How can prompting for AI coding improve productivity without sacrificing quality?
Effective prompting yields reliable AI-generated code. Use clear objectives, provide context, specify constraints, and pair prompts with human reviews, tests, and refactoring.
What are best practices for AI security in software when using AI-generated code?
Prioritize AI security in software by conducting security audits, running in sandboxed environments, avoiding secrets in prompts, validating outputs, and continuous monitoring and governance.
What is the future of software development with AI, and will humans still drive the code?
The future will be shaped by humans guiding AI, defining standards, and building robust systems. AI accelerates development but requires oversight, testing, and ethical considerations.
How can developers stay relevant in AI-assisted web development?
Stay relevant by mastering AI toolchains, refining prompting strategies, deepening architectural skills, and focusing on security, accessibility, and domain expertise. Continuous learning keeps you ahead.
What risks should you watch for in AI-assisted web development, and how can you mitigate them?
Risks include data leakage, misgenerated code, and overreliance on AI. Mitigate with thorough testing, peer reviews, privacy controls, secure coding practices, and transparent governance.
How should you evaluate AI-generated code for reliability and security in AI-assisted workflows, and how does prompting for AI coding influence this evaluation, considering AI security in software?
Evaluate AI-generated code by correctness tests, performance benchmarks, security reviews, and compliance checks. Combine automated checks with human review and defensive coding.
What is an effective workflow for integrating AI tools into web development projects with emphasis on AI in web development?
Define project scope, use prompting effectively, integrate AI into CI/CD, run early tests, document decisions, and maintain reproducibility. Pair automation with human oversight.
Can you share real-world examples of AI-assisted web development and the lessons learned about the impact on developers?
Examples include building plugins or dashboards with AI, automating content calendars, and debugging aids. Lessons: AI accelerates tasks but requires security care, careful data handling, and ongoing learning.
| Topic | Key Points |
|---|---|
| Will AI replace developers? | The fear is common, but the base content argues the answer is conditional: AI will shift roles and boost productivity rather than simply replace people; success depends on how developers adapt and use AI. |
| Historical analogy: steam vehicles vs. regulation | Steam-powered transport faced restrictions (Locomotives Act 1865) but cars eventually transformed mobility. The idea is that AI can be disruptive yet ultimately accelerates development, with regulation and adoption shaping outcomes. |
| AI progress and positive usage | Since 2021, AI tools (GPT-3, Copilot) have supported writing, tutorials, and coding. Many projects were built with AI assistance (e.g., WordPress.com Content Calendar in ~2 hours). Generally positive experiences across plugins, games, and utilities. |
| Risks when AI goes wrong | AI can misbehave or be confidently incorrect: security vulnerabilities, data leaks, production data loss, misleading ‘fixed’ claims, and incorrect code. Real-world examples include mis-specified anonymization and implementation gaps that tests reveal. |
| Examples of fragile AI outcomes | Specific cases such as building WP Debug (Electron) with extra effort due to unfamiliar tech, and the need to rework AI-suggested changes after testing; vibecode-style tooling can mislead if not validated. |
| AI won’t replace adaptable developers | AI is an enabler: those who adapt and use AI judiciously can deliver faster results. The analogy to early automobiles suggests adoption will occur, but human oversight and skill remain essential. |
| What to do now: two key takeaways | Takeaways: 1) manage hype and separate marketing from facts; 2) learn how AI works (prompting, context, tools) and apply solid software practices (defined scope, planning, tests, security audits, ongoing education). Use AI as a productivity aid, not a replacement for human expertise. |
| Future outlook | The future of web development will be shaped by those who embrace AI tools with healthy skepticism, prioritizing learning and governance. AI will boost productivity while demanding continued human oversight and evolving skills. |
Summary
Conclusion: AI in web development is reshaping how teams design, build, test, and deploy software. It will augment human capability, not simply replace it, so success depends on thoughtful adoption, ongoing learning, and strong software practices. To thrive in AI-rich web environments, developers should manage hype, understand AI capabilities and limits, and apply scope, testing, security auditing, and education. As AI in web development tools mature, the most resilient teams will combine curiosity with disciplined oversight to deliver secure, maintainable, and faster web experiences.
AI in web development is reshaping how we design, build, and scale sites, and this shift is already changing how teams collaborate, how projects are planned, and what users expect from fast, reliable online experiences. As I watch the evolution of AI-powered tools and frameworks, I see AI-assisted web development enabling faster prototyping, smarter error detection, accessibility improvements, and more responsive, personalized interfaces across devices. Yet the changes raise questions about the impact of AI on developers, productivity, and the balance between creativity and automation as we brainstorm features, tests, deployment pipelines, and the need for ongoing governance. Smart prompting for AI coding helps teams craft better commands, guide model behavior, and reduce mundane drudgery, while still requiring human judgment to validate results, review security implications, and ensure maintainable code. Ultimately, discussions about the future of software development with AI and AI security in software center on security, governance, workforce reskilling, and continuous learning, so we can harness the benefits without compromising safety, privacy, or quality, and prepare for a responsible, scalable era of digital products.
In Latent Semantic Indexing (LSI) terms, the topic is framed through a network of related notions rather than a single label, opening space for machine-assisted development, AI-powered coding aides, and intelligent automation to guide software creation. These terms reflect the same underlying shift in different contexts, emphasizing how automated reasoning, data-driven design, and predictive coding reshape workflows while preserving essential human oversight. Viewed this way, teams can explore practical patterns such as autonomous testing, code generation, and governance practices that align innovation with security and reliability.
You’re right to frame AI in web development as a revolution that depends on how we use it, not merely what it can do. Like the early steam-powered road vehicles, AI’s arrival invites disruption and opportunity alike. The goal isn’t to replace developers but to shift what we do, blending human judgment with machine-assisted productivity to move faster while keeping quality and safety intact.
Your personal history with AI hits the right note: most of the time AI gets it right and speeds things up, but there are notable misfires that remind us to stay vigilant. From security leaks to misused examples and hallucinations, these stories show why human oversight, testing, and context are essential.
AI won’t eliminate the need for developers who understand systems, security, and user needs. Those who adapt—learning prompting, integrating tools responsibly, and building robust processes—will extract value while maintaining trust with clients and users.
Two practical takeaways: first, learn how AI works, what it does well and badly, and how to prompt effectively; second, embed good software practices: define scope, plan steps, write tests early, audit outputs, and implement security reviews. Use AI as a productivity aid, not a substitute for critical thinking and craftsmanship.
To future-proof your career, treat AI adoption as a workflow upgrade: experiment on small projects, share findings with the community, and invest in ongoing education. Embrace skepticism: celebrate the wins but quarantine the failures, and maintain a culture of continuous improvement.
Want me to tailor this into a final blog post, slides, or an outline for a talk? I can rewrite for a specific audience, extract key takeaways into bullet points, or polish the prose for clarity and impact.

